2. Tom Byrne Park
Located in the heart of Atmore, Tom Byrne Park offers a peaceful and fun outdoor experience for the entire family. The park features lush green spaces perfect for picnics, walking trails, and plenty of room for children to run and play. With its well-maintained playground equipment, it's an ideal spot for kids to enjoy nature and engage in physical activities.
3. Heritage Park
If you’re looking for a mix of history and recreation, Heritage Park is the place to go. This park features relocated historic buildings, and its unique setting offers children a chance to explore Alabama’s past while enjoying modern amenities like playgrounds and a splash pad. It’s a great location for families to enjoy a fun day out while also learning a little bit about the local history.
4. Houston Avery Park
This park is perfect for families looking for a place to cool off in the summer. Houston Avery Park is home to a swimming pool, playgrounds, and picnic areas. It’s an excellent spot for kids to play, swim, and enjoy the outdoors while parents relax and take in the scenery. Whether you’re looking to splash around or simply spend time in nature, this park offers something for everyone.
5. Magnolia Branch Wildlife Reserve
For families who love nature, Magnolia Branch Wildlife Reserve offers a beautiful setting for a day of outdoor fun. The reserve spans over 6,000 acres of timberland and provides various activities such as canoeing, hiking, birdwatching, and zip-lining. It’s a great spot for children to explore wildlife, connect with nature, and engage in physical activities in a tranquil environment.
6. Little River State Forest
If you’re willing to take a short drive out of Atmore, Little River State Forest offers even more outdoor activities. Located just 12 miles north of Atmore, the park is ideal for fishing, hiking, and enjoying the natural beauty of Alabama’s forests. It’s a peaceful spot for families to connect with nature and enjoy some quality time together in a serene environment.
7. Wind Creek Atmore Arcade
For families looking for indoor entertainment, Wind Creek Atmore features an arcade that’s sure to keep the kids entertained for hours. The arcade offers a variety of video games, redemption games, and rewards tickets, providing both fun and prizes for everyone in the family. It’s an excellent option for families looking for indoor fun during hot summer days or rainy afternoons.
8. Wind Creek Cinema
After a day of play, wind down with a family-friendly movie at the Wind Creek Cinema. Whether you’re looking for the latest blockbuster or a fun animated film, the cinema offers a great way to relax and enjoy a movie night together. It’s perfect for families with younger children or those who just need a quiet moment after an exciting day of adventure.
9. Greater Escambia Council for the Arts
For families interested in arts and culture, Greater Escambia Council for the Arts is a fantastic place to explore. The theater features local productions and performances that showcase the talent of the community. Attending a play or musical can be a fun and educational experience for kids, allowing them to engage with the arts and appreciate different forms of creativity.
10. Local Festivals
Atmore hosts several annual festivals that are perfect for families. Mayfest, Old-Time Fiddlers' Convention, and Williams Station Day offer a wide range of activities, from arts and crafts to live music and food. These festivals bring the community together and provide children with a chance to enjoy games, performances, and other family-friendly fun.
